Mark On Wed, Oct 21, 2009 at 5:50 PM, gonzoprosperity <[email protected]> wrote: > > Using Transfer 1.1. I have an invalid XML model definition file and > Transfer is throwing this error: > > invalid component definition, can't find > transfer.com.exception.InValidXMLException > > Thrown from (transfer/com/io/XMLFileReader.cfc: line 107): > > 105: } > 106: > 107: createObject("component", > "transfer.com.exception.InValidXMLException").init(arguments.xmlPath, > detail); > 108: } > 109: </cfscript> > > But in looking at the code that CFC is in fact located at: > > transfer.com.io.exception.InValidXMLException > > And sure enough, when I change XMLFileReader.cfc line 107 and the > correct the path to the InValidXMLException.cfc to: > > transfer.com.io.exception.InValidXMLException > > > All is well. > > Well, Transfer works but my XML is still invalid.
